Johann Gottfried Melos

Summary

Johann Gottfried Melos is a human[1]. His place of birth was Großmonra[2]. He was born on January 1, 1770[3]. He passed away in Weimar[4]. He died on February 16, 1828[5]. He worked as a writer[6].
